What Is a Managed Website and Hosting Service?
A managed website and hosting service goes beyond just keeping your website live. It includes regular updates, backups, security scans, speed optimizations, and minor content updates — all specifically for your WordPress website. It’s essentially a comprehensive service that ensures your site stays secure, fast, and up-to-date without you having to lift a finger.

Why These Services Are Important
Maintaining your website is critical for several reasons. First, an up-to-date site is more secure. When WordPress, themes, or plugins are out of date, they can become vulnerable to security threats. Hackers often exploit outdated code to gain access to your website, potentially stealing information or defacing your site. Imagine your site being hacked right before the busy season — it could cause a lot of damage to your reputation.
Second, your website’s speed and functionality depend on proper maintenance. A slow website is frustrating for visitors and can lead to a higher bounce rate (meaning people leave your site without interacting). Search engines like Google also take speed into account when ranking your site in search results, so an optimized website can help with your SEO efforts.

Can’t I Just Turn On Automatic Updates and Forget About It?
While this might seem like a simple solution, it can actually cause more harm than good. Automatic updates don’t account for compatibility issues between WordPress, your themes, and your plugins. If an update is applied automatically and it breaks something on your site, you might only realize it when visitors complain or the next time you check your website. With a managed service, the service provider applies updates carefully and tests the site to ensure everything works as expected.
Doesn’t My Hosting Company Already Do This?
Many standard website hosting companies are just a parking spot for your website. Most don’t handle updates, backups, security scans, or any of the essential maintenance tasks that keep your site running smoothly. It’s like buying a car without a mechanic — sure, it works, but you’re responsible for keeping it in top shape. A managed website and hosting service takes care of the heavy lifting for you, so you don’t have to worry about a thing.
